~niedbalski/charms/trusty/quantum-gateway/fix-lp-1308557

« back to all changes in this revision

Viewing changes to hooks/charmhelpers/contrib/openstack/neutron.py

  • Committer: James Page
  • Date: 2013-11-17 21:53:21 UTC
  • mfrom: (37.1.5 quantum-gateway)
  • Revision ID: james.page@canonical.com-20131117215321-o4o6uje3itj2e4se
[gandelman-a][james-page] NVP support

Show diffs side-by-side

added added

removed removed

Lines of Context:
34
34
            'services': ['quantum-plugin-openvswitch-agent'],
35
35
            'packages': [[headers_package(), 'openvswitch-datapath-dkms'],
36
36
                         ['quantum-plugin-openvswitch-agent']],
 
37
            'server_packages': ['quantum-server',
 
38
                                'quantum-plugin-openvswitch'],
 
39
            'server_services': ['quantum-server']
37
40
        },
38
41
        'nvp': {
39
42
            'config': '/etc/quantum/plugins/nicira/nvp.ini',
40
43
            'driver': 'quantum.plugins.nicira.nicira_nvp_plugin.'
41
44
                      'QuantumPlugin.NvpPluginV2',
 
45
            'contexts': [
 
46
                context.SharedDBContext(user=config('neutron-database-user'),
 
47
                                        database=config('neutron-database'),
 
48
                                        relation_prefix='neutron')],
42
49
            'services': [],
43
50
            'packages': [],
 
51
            'server_packages': ['quantum-server',
 
52
                                'quantum-plugin-nicira'],
 
53
            'server_services': ['quantum-server']
44
54
        }
45
55
    }
46
56
 
60
70
            'services': ['neutron-plugin-openvswitch-agent'],
61
71
            'packages': [[headers_package(), 'openvswitch-datapath-dkms'],
62
72
                         ['quantum-plugin-openvswitch-agent']],
 
73
            'server_packages': ['neutron-server',
 
74
                                'neutron-plugin-openvswitch'],
 
75
            'server_services': ['neutron-server']
63
76
        },
64
77
        'nvp': {
65
78
            'config': '/etc/neutron/plugins/nicira/nvp.ini',
66
79
            'driver': 'neutron.plugins.nicira.nicira_nvp_plugin.'
67
80
                      'NeutronPlugin.NvpPluginV2',
 
81
            'contexts': [
 
82
                context.SharedDBContext(user=config('neutron-database-user'),
 
83
                                        database=config('neutron-database'),
 
84
                                        relation_prefix='neutron')],
68
85
            'services': [],
69
86
            'packages': [],
 
87
            'server_packages': ['neutron-server',
 
88
                                'neutron-plugin-nicira'],
 
89
            'server_services': ['neutron-server']
70
90
        }
71
91
    }
72
92